No evil can remain buried forever, as disgraced journalist Thomas Brooks discovers when a wave of death grips the rural Kentucky town of Gray Hollow in terror. Following a very public humiliation, Thomas is looking for a story to get him back on the map-and free of the small town newspaper where he serves out his exile. The apparent murder of a stranger seems to be just what the opportunistic reporter needs, until he discovers the death is merely the start of something bigger. Also investigating the murder is Sheriff Jezebel Woods, who doesn't approve of Thomas' sensationalist intentions. Mounting deaths force the pair to set aside their differences to confront a force that threatens to destroy the entire town. At the center of the mystery is the disappearance of a boy named Salem Alistair, who designed a series of grotesque scarecrows for his parents' farm-scarecrows that are turning up at each subsequent crime scene. Thomas begins to doubt his uneasy alliance with the sheriff when he realizes Jezebel has her own secret history with Salem Alistair. Thomas and Jezebel are completely unprepared to face the supernatural force at odds with Gray Hollow. As the killings continue, and the town slowly begins to yield its dark secrets, the truth will pit Thomas and Jezebel on a collision course with true evil.

A short story set before the events of The Wrath of Lords. Before he was her greatest weapon, he was her enemy. Nora of Connacht has a war to win. Esben Berengar, the most dangerous man in the five kingdoms of Fál, has other plans. Abducted by Berengar, Nora seeks to escape before her captor delivers her to the Ice Queen for reasons of his own. Nora regards Berengar as a heartless monster; Berengar thinks Nora is a naïve idealist. But there is more to each than the other suspects, and even monsters can do the unexpected.
Being a warden is tough work at the best of times. Keeping the tenuous peace between the five kingdoms of Fál is a difficult business, especially in a land of monsters and magic. Esben Berengar, the realm's most feared warden, relies on his wits and his axe to deal with unscrupulous rulers, bloodthirsty outlaws, and the occasional witch. When the king of Munster is murdered, Berengar is called upon to investigate. Many had cause to want the king dead, and treachery lurks behind every corner. As tensions between humans and all others threaten to boil over, the warden finds himself reluctantly partnered with Morwen, Munster's court magician, to solve the murder before the killer strikes at the royal family again.
After the emergence of the destructive, godlike Titans, the world is more dangerous than ever. When drone pilot David Hunter is recruited to join a top-secret military program, he learns the government has captured the Titan Prometheus. Once considered a hero by many, Prometheus is now an empty shell, retrofitted with technology to serve as a new kind of drone--and it's David's task to use the Titan's powers on the government's behalf. David has his own reasons to distrust Titans, but when he discovers some vestiges of Prometheus' consciousness remain, it sets in motion a course of events that will cause him to learn what it means to be a hero.
A short story set before the events of The Blood of Kings. From the time she was a child, Morwen of Cashel has dreamed of becoming a mage. Finally, the day of choosing has arrived, and the entire kingdom waits with bated breath to see if she will join the ranks of the heroes of old. To earn acceptance into the order of mages, Morwen must first pass a series of rigorous trials, but no one could prepare her for the greatest challenge of all-choosing between her heart's desire and doing what is right.
